Original pull-request #103052

Do not merge this PR manually

This pull-request is a first step of an automated backporting.
It contains changes similar to calling git cherry-pick locally.
If you intend to continue backporting the changes, then resolve all conflicts if any.
Otherwise, if you do not want to backport them, then just close this pull-request.

The check results does not matter at this step - you can safely ignore them.

Troubleshooting

If the conflicts were resolved in a wrong way

If this cherry-pick PR is completely screwed by a wrong conflicts resolution, and you want to recreate it:

  • delete the pr-cherrypick label from the PR
  • delete this branch from the repository

You also need to check the Original pull-request for pr-backports-created label, and delete if it's presented there
